Effects of Different Carbon and Nitrogen Sources on Physicochemical Properties and Volatile Components of Pineapple Vinegar

Considering the deficiencies such as low substrate utilization rate, prone to lose typical flavor, and weak taste in liquid fermentation process of pineapple vinegar, the paper intended to explore the effects of different carbon sources (sucrose, inulin) and nitrogen sources (chromium-rich yeast, soybean protein) on the physicochemical indexes (total acid, reducing sugar, total polyphenols and total acid), antioxidant activity (DPPH free radical and ABTS+ clearance rate) and volatile components in the fermentation process of pineapple vinegar, which was aimed to improve substrate utilization and vinegar quality. The results showed that not only different carbon sources and but also nitrogen sources could significantly increase the acid production of acetic acid bacteria, and the abilities of nitrogen sources to promote the utilization of reducing sugar and acid production of acetic acid bacteria were better than that of carbon sources. The nitrogen source had higher effects on the contents of total polyphenols, total flavonoids and the ability of scavenging DPPH and ABTS free radicals than carbon source. Besides, a total of 37 volatile components were detected in pineapple vinegar under four treatments, mainly included esters, alcohols, acids, phenols, ketones and so on. The total concentration of volatile components of pineapple vinegar in nitrogen source treatments was higher than that in carbon source treatments. The concentrations of esters and acids were the highest with value of 3712.37 μg/L and 972.97 μg/L, and were 6.39 times and 8.76 times of those in the sucrose treatment, respectively. Compared with sucrose treatment, the total concentration of volatile components in other treatments increased by 3.78-5.19 times. There were two key volatile compounds in the sucrose treatment (ethyl decanoate and phenylethanol), ethyl caproate, isoamyl acetate, ethyl decanoate and phenyl ethyl) were key volatile compounds in the inulin treatment, and five key volatile compounds in the nitrogen source group were isoamyl acetate, ethyl caproate, ethyl decanoate, linalool and phenylethanol. Appropriate addition of organic nitrogen source could promote acetic acid fermentation process, maximize the fermentation potential of acetobacter, enhance antioxidant activity of pineapple vinegar, to improve the content of total phenol and total flavone, and pineapple vinegar flavor.
